About

Basketball training and competitive teams for kids kindergarten through eighth grade, with programs split by age and skill level. The Rising Stars Academy focuses on building fundamentals and confidence for younger players, while the Elite teams require tryouts and target serious players ready for higher-level competition. Perfect for kids who want structured skill development alongside team play. The program runs multi-week academies during fall and summer, plus Friday Night Jams that combine drills with competitive games. Tryouts happen for the Elite teams, but the Rising Stars programs welcome newer players looking to build their game.
